    I was involved in the chemical industry and can back up what you say, in our case all the routine chemical analysis results were meticulously filed, but it was a long time before the penny dropped with someone who realised that the reagents used in the analysis were not being included. External audits over several years never flagged this up, so although we were selling a bulk product that the paperwork showed as being fully traceable, there was this gaping flaw in the system. This was with a well known global petroleum company who, when it came to paper,work, were super keen.

    A quality system accreditation is no more a guarantee of quality than a 5* hygiene rating guarantees that the local takeaway will not have an off-day when you happen to go in for a burger - it's about degrees of confidence, hopefully reducing the need to test/ inspect everything you make or do.

    Whether, for example, RTC, sending in the auditors to WCRC would achieve anything more than existing processes I've no idea, but it would have a cost associated with it.

    Paperwork trails are indeed worthless. I have come across so many examples over the years. Assemblies that have been certified as having passed a hydrostatic test that exhibit no sign of internal moisture. A little unpaid overtime and the bursting of a hose or the loss of a poorly swaged fitting or even the lack of tested electrical continuity just make you less trusting and more determined to take all testing in house. Worse are those assemblies that are so poor that they could not be tested in the first place - swivel females do not work if they have been installed the wrong way round.
    Then you have the issue of materials that do not meet the specification required or certified. We all know of the problems caused by copper supplied for use as stay material that was unfit for purpose. IR has taken matters into his own hands and has equipped himself to double check in house.
    Take things further and check on the those companies heavily involved in the oil industry, where they will accept steel from, where not and why. I experienced not only fraudulent materials but also sub standard manufacture.
    Paperwork only confirms paperwork. It guarantees nothing.
